Hatton will make a comeback
It’s a comeback for Pride of Manchester Ricky Hatton after his promoter confirmed a fight between him and Mexican Juan Manuel Marquez next year.
Juan Manuel accepted the challenge and would love to come to Manchester as confirmed by Richard Schaefer, head of Golden Boy Promotions.
Marquez lost his bout to the returning Floyd Mayweather in September, getting himself outdone in 12 rounds while Hatton still licks his wounds after losing to Mayweather and experiencing a humiliating two-round KO by Filipino Manny Pacquiao, which is the world’s current welterweight champion, in May.
Marquez is a former world champion at featherweight, super-featherweight and lightweight, and a fight against Hatton would almost certainly take place at light-welterweight, Hatton’s natural division.
But his most recent appearance in a ring was against another Mexican in Chavo Guerrero, whom he ‘fought’ at a WWE wrestling show in Sheffield last weekend.
